If you're a smoker looking for a healthier alternative, you may have considered herbal cigarettes. But are they really safe? In this blog, we'll take a closer look at herbal cigarettes, their side effects, and whether they're a safe choice for smokers.

What Are Herbal Cigarettes?

Herbal cigarettes are made from a blend of herbs, spices, and botanicals, rather than tobacco. They're often marketed as a healthier alternative to traditional cigarettes, but are they really safe?

Herbal Cigarettes Safe? Cons of Herbal Cigarettes

1.     Burning Risks:

Burning herbs can produce toxic chemicals, which can harm your lungs over time. Even without nicotine, the smoke from burning plants can cause damage.

2.    False Safety:

The word "herbal" can be misleading, making people think they're completely safe. However, just because something is natural doesn't mean it's safe to smoke. Herbal cigarette smoke can still contain hazardous chemicals.

3.  No Strict Rules:

Unlike regular cigarettes, herbal cigarettes aren't regulated strictly. This means that the ingredients and levels of harmful substances can vary significantly between brands and products.

Herbal Cigarettes Side Effects

While herbal cigarettes may seem like a harmless alternative to tobacco, they can still have some side effects. Here are some of the most common herbal cigarettes side effects:

1. Respiratory Problems:

Herbal cigarettes can still irritate the lungs and airways, even if they don't contain tobacco.

  • Coughing and wheezing

  • Shortness of breath

  • Chest tightness

2.    Allergic Reactions:

Some people may be allergic to certain herbs or ingredients in herbal cigarettes.

  •  Itching

  • Swelling and redness

  • Anaphylaxis (in severe cases)

3.    Interactions with Medications:

Herbal cigarettes can interact with certain medications, such as blood thinners and diabetes medications.

  •  Increased risk of bleeding

  • Changes in blood sugar levels

Alternatives to Herbal Cigarettes

As we have read above the cons and side-effects of herbal cigarettes, the best option is to quit smoking altogether. Here are a few ways to support your quitting journey:

  1. Understand Your Triggers: Identify situations or emotions that make you want to smoke and find alternative coping mechanisms.

  2. Nicotine Replacement Therapy: Use patches, gums, or lozenges to reduce withdrawal symptoms.

  3. Stay Busy: Engage in activities like hobbies or exercise to keep your hands and mind occupied.

  4. Counseling and Support: Counseling and support groups can provide you with the motivation and support you need to quit smoking.

  5. Ayurvedic Remedy: Use of natural herbs like Tulsi, Valerian, Mulethi, Jaiphal, and others help with quitting smoking, manage withdrawal symptoms, and improve overall lung function.
